I'll never forget the first time I heard Cajun fiddling and singing - it was about 35 years ago when the Balfa Brothers and Marc Savoy gave a concert in Seattle. It raised the hair on the back of my neck; it was so reminiscent of the French-Canadian-influenced country fiddling of my northeastern US childhood. If you know your history, you understand the connection. But *wow* the southern twang made Cajun even more interesting. And I loved it then and I love it now; it sends me into orbit.

These guys haven't diluted that wonderful tradition one single bit! You know that has to be watched out for, as too many players start out in a traditional folk idiom and then decide to "improve" it with the addition of other influences. That makes the music into something else, often interesting but no longer in the straight original style. No problem here: Young and Savoy sound totally authentic to my ears. (My ears that originated in traditional folk and then received a thorough musical training/education.)

Yes, yes, yes, this is highly recommended. And thanks to these two musicians for recording.

Linzay Young and Joel Savoy's self-titled album is the perfect record to kick off the new Valcour Records Artist Series that is designed to release quality recordings of Louisiana musicians that wish to share aspects of their artistry that are perhaps not as widely known as their more public gigs. Aptly described as "kitchen music, plain and simple" it features good-old Cajun fiddle music from two great musicians widely known for their ability to swing.

Linzay and Joel have played music together for almost 15 years and it shows. They learned the fiddle together in Eunice at the Savoy Music Center jams as kids (I remember seeing Linzay and Joel performing fiddle songs together as little boys at the Liberty Theater in Eunice in the early 1990s). The boys went on to found the Red Stick Ramblers in 1999. Linzay continued his career with the Ramblers after Joel's departure in 2005 and Joel started the successful avant-garde Louisiana record company Valcour Records. These boys know Cajun-fiddling and play together like musical brothers, reminiscent of the work of Dennis McGee and Sady Courville. This album is exemplary of their long-standing musical relationship: they succeeded in recording these tracks in just one afternoon in Eunice, La at Joel's Savoy Faire Studio.

Many of the songs on the album pay homage to shared fiddling heroes like Dennis McGee, Wade Fruge, and Cheese Reed. There are some surprises and interesting choices however. Linzay sings "Si Tu Voudrais Marier" a song he learned a Joe's Acadiens recording. The song many people may be familiar with is the a capella version sung by Lula Landry that is a call and response between a woman and then the man where she isn't pleased by any of his offerings except his unwavering love, especially not his gold and silver.

A serious KO for Joel Savoy and Linzay Young. What do you get when you put two guys that have played music together for years in a room with some mics and a recorder. THIS! The musicianship is superb. The song selection is exactly what you expect. The whole album gives a feeling like you were invited to play bourree somewhere and two guys quit the game to play music in the corner. Although the arrangements are somewhat more simple than some other modern cajun recordings (no bass, accordion or drums), I count that as a positive. You can really hear every inflection in the French vocals and every slide on the fiddle. Five stars on this Valcour masterpiece.
